Italian Grand Prix: Leclerc Crushes Mercedes in Front of Tifosi

Left to fend for himself with his teammate struggling, Charles Leclerc held off a pair of hard-charging Mercedes to win the 2019 Italian Grand Prix. Withstanding the efforts of both Lewis Hamilton and Valtteri Bottas, Leclerc managed to record the first win for Ferrari at Monza since Fernando Alonso did so in 2010. His second win in as many races, Leclerc triumphed in a lights-to-flag battle with the Silver Arrows that will go down as one of the Scuderia's all-time great home victories.
